#2e1265 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e1265 is composed of 18% red, 7.1%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 82.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 260.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 23.3%. #2e1265 color hex could be obtained by blending #5c24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#2e1265 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e1265 has RGB values of R:46, G:18,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3019365.

Shades and Tints of #2e1265
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f4effc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e1265
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3b3c is the less saturated color, while #2a0473 is the most saturated one.
